    This detached freehold property on Mount Pleasant last sold in February 2008 for £170,000. Based on price growth in the CF63 district since then, its estimated current value is £286,784 — placing it in the 46th percentile nationally and the 81st percentile within CF63. The property covers 152 m² (1,636 sq ft), giving an estimated value of £1,887 per m². The EPC rating is D, with a potential rating of B.

    CF63 covers Barry and surrounding areas in Vale of Glamorgan, south Wales. It is a mixed residential district with strong community appeal, offering a blend of suburban neighbourhoods and seaside character.
